 examples of solar energy in everyday life

Solar energy is a clean, renewable resource increasingly integrated into everyday life. It harnesses the sun’s power to provide sustainable solutions for various needs, reducing reliance on fossil fuels and lowering carbon emissions.

  1. Solar-Powered Homes
    Residential solar panels convert sunlight into electricity to power appliances, lighting, and heating systems. Excess energy can be stored in batteries or sent back to the grid, offering energy independence and cost savings.

  2. Solar Water Heaters
    Solar water heating systems use sunlight to heat water for bathing, cleaning, and cooking. They are a practical alternative to electric or gas water heaters, particularly in sunny regions.

  3. Outdoor Solar Lighting
    Solar lights for gardens, driveways, and pathways absorb sunlight during the day and illuminate at night. They require no wiring and significantly reduce electricity bills.

  4. Solar Cookers
    Solar cookers use reflective materials to concentrate sunlight for cooking food. They are an eco-friendly option, particularly useful in areas without access to conventional fuels.

  5. Solar-Powered Gadgets
    From portable chargers and flashlights to solar backpacks, solar-powered gadgets are convenient and eco-friendly, especially for outdoor activities.

  6. Solar Agriculture Tools
    Farmers use solar-powered water pumps, irrigation systems, and crop dryers to improve efficiency and sustainability in agriculture.

  7. Solar Transportation
    Solar energy is powering innovative transportation solutions, such as solar buses, boats, and cars, providing a glimpse of a cleaner future.

These examples highlight the versatility and practicality of solar energy in everyday life. By adopting solar technologies, individuals and communities can contribute to a more sustainable and environmentally friendly future.
